* Path, road, or way: This is the most common meaning. It can refer to a physical path, a metaphorical journey, or even a course of action. For example, "Ara o te Ao" translates to "Path of the World" or "Way of Life."
* Bridge: This meaning is often used metaphorically, referring to a connection or link between two things.
* Line, streak: This meaning is less common but can be used to describe something that is long and narrow.
It's important to note that the exact meaning of "ara" will depend on the context of the phrase or sentence in which it is used.
